How to Get Rid of Japanese Beetles Without Making It Worse
The most effective way to get rid of Japanese beetles in a home garden is hand-picking them into soapy water early in the morning, when cool temperatures make them sluggish and easy to knock off plants. It sounds primitive next to sprays and traps, but university extension programs consistently rank it as the most reliable approach for small properties, and it has no effect on pollinators.
The single most important thing to know is what not to do. Japanese beetle traps use pheromone and floral lures that pull in far more beetles than they capture, and research has repeatedly shown they increase damage on the property where they are placed. This guide covers what actually works, how to treat the grub stage in your lawn, which plants they target, and why realistic expectations matter more than any product.

How to Get Rid of Japanese Beetles
Japanese beetles (Popillia japonica) arrived in New Jersey around 1916 and have since spread across most of the eastern and midwestern United States. Adults are about 0.5 in with metallic green bodies and copper wing covers, plus five tufts of white hair along each side of the abdomen, which distinguishes them from similar-looking native beetles.
Adults emerge in early summer and feed for roughly six to eight weeks, skeletonizing leaves by eating the tissue between the veins and leaving a lace-like remnant. They feed in groups because damaged leaves release volatile compounds that attract more beetles, which is why an infestation seems to appear all at once and concentrates on a few plants.
That aggregation behavior shapes every effective control strategy. Removing beetles early reduces the chemical signal that recruits more, so acting in the first days of an outbreak accomplishes more than the same effort three weeks later. Waiting until the damage is obvious means the recruitment cycle is already running.
Hand-Picking: The Method That Works

Go out between 7 and 9 in the morning while temperatures are still low and the beetles are sluggish. Hold a bucket of soapy water under the foliage and tap or shake the branch, and the beetles drop straight in rather than flying off, which is exactly what they do later in the day.
Plain water with a squirt of dish soap is all that is needed, since the soap breaks surface tension so the beetles sink rather than crawling out. Empty the bucket well away from the garden. Do not crush beetles on the plant, because damaged beetles release the same aggregation signal that draws in more.
Consistency beats intensity. Daily collection through the six to eight week flight period keeps populations manageable on a typical home garden, and the effort drops off sharply after the first two weeks if you start early. It is tedious, it is free, and it does not harm bees, and for most home gardeners it outperforms everything sold in a bottle.
Why Japanese Beetle Traps Make Things Worse

Commercial traps combine a floral scent that attracts both sexes with a sex pheromone that attracts males, and the combination is extraordinarily effective at pulling beetles in from a wide area, sometimes several hundred yards. That part works. The problem is that a substantial fraction of the beetles drawn in never reach the trap.
Research at multiple land-grant universities has found that plants near traps sustain more damage than plants on properties without traps. The beetles arrive, encounter foliage on the way, and settle to feed instead. Placing a trap in a garden is effectively advertising the garden to every beetle in the neighborhood.
There are two narrow exceptions. Traps have a role in large-scale monitoring and survey work, where the goal is detection rather than control, and they can help if placed far from anything you value, meaning at least 200 ft away and downwind, ideally at the far edge of a large property. For a typical suburban yard, no such placement exists, and the honest advice is not to buy them.
Neem Oil and Other Sprays
Neem oil containing azadirachtin gives moderate results. It works as a feeding deterrent and disrupts development rather than killing on contact, so it will not clear an active infestation immediately, and it needs reapplication every five to seven days and after rain. Applied consistently through the flight period, it reduces damage noticeably.
Timing protects pollinators and is not optional. Spray in the evening after bees have stopped foraging, never on open flowers, and never during the day. Neem is toxic to bees while wet, and Japanese beetles concentrate on exactly the flowering plants bees visit, so careless application does real harm.
Stronger insecticides exist and carry real costs. Carbaryl and pyrethroids kill adults on contact but also kill pollinators, predatory insects, and parasitoid wasps, and they often trigger secondary outbreaks of spider mites by removing the predators that controlled them, including the beetles described in our guide to what ladybugs eat. Systemic neonicotinoids move into pollen and nectar and should not be used on flowering plants at all. Insecticidal soap and diatomaceous earth are largely ineffective against an insect this heavily armored, and homemade sprays that circulate online have no evidence behind them. Treating the Grubs in Your Lawn
The larval stage lives underground, feeding on grass roots and producing brown patches that peel up like carpet. Adults lay eggs in irrigated turf through mid to late summer, grubs feed through autumn, overwinter deep in the soil, and return to feed briefly in spring before pupating.
Beneficial nematodes, specifically Heterorhabditis bacteriophora, are the most reliable biological option. Apply them in late summer when grubs are small, water thoroughly before and after application, and apply in the evening because ultraviolet light kills them. They need consistently moist soil to move and infect, so a dry lawn wastes the application entirely.
Milky spore is widely sold and disappoints most buyers. The bacterium takes years to establish, works poorly in cooler northern soils, and independent trials have found inconsistent results against Japanese beetle grubs specifically. It is not the reliable long-term fix that marketing suggests. A simpler alternative is to stop irrigating the lawn during the egg-laying weeks of July and August, since eggs and newly hatched grubs die in dry soil. Accepting a dormant brown lawn for a few weeks reduces the next generation substantially.
Row Covers and Physical Barriers
Floating row covers give complete protection where they can be used. Lightweight fabric over hoops physically excludes beetles from vegetables, small fruit, and ornamental foliage, and it costs nothing beyond the material once installed.
The limitation is pollination. Anything that needs insect pollination cannot stay covered while flowering, so row covers suit leafy crops, herbs, and young plants rather than squash, cucumbers, or fruiting shrubs. Some gardeners cover during peak beetle weeks and uncover for a few hours in the morning for pollination, which is labor-intensive but workable on a small scale.
Fine mesh netting works for individual valuable plants such as a favorite rose or a young fruit tree, though it needs sealing at the base since beetles land and crawl upward. Covers must go on before beetles arrive in late June, because installing them over already-infested plants simply traps the beetles inside with the foliage.
Plants They Love and Plants They Avoid
Japanese beetles feed on more than 300 plant species, but they show clear preferences, and a handful of favorites draw the heaviest damage. Roses, grapes, lindens, Japanese maples, birches, crabapples, cherries, plums, raspberries, hollyhocks, and hibiscus sit at the top of the list, and beetles will strip these while ignoring plants a few feet away.
Some plants are consistently avoided. Lilac, forsythia, boxwood, dogwood, red maple, oak, magnolia, yew, arborvitae, holly, rhododendron, and most conifers rarely sustain meaningful damage, along with garden herbs including rosemary, thyme, and chives.
Plant selection is the only permanent solution available to a home gardener. Replacing a repeatedly destroyed linden or Japanese maple with a red maple or an oak ends the problem for that plant permanently, whereas every other method has to be repeated every summer. Where a favorite plant is worth defending, concentrate hand-picking on it and accept damage elsewhere.
Japanese Beetles in the House
Japanese beetles do not overwinter indoors, and this is a common misidentification. They spend winter as grubs in soil, and any beetle appearing in your house in autumn or winter is something else, most often an Asian lady beetle, a carpet beetle, or a ground beetle that wandered in.
The distinction matters because the fixes differ. Asian lady beetles aggregate on sun-warmed walls in autumn and enter through gaps, which our guide to the Asian lady beetle covers, while carpet beetles breed indoors on natural fibers and stored food, described in our guide to carpet beetle bites. Neither responds to Japanese beetle measures.
A genuine Japanese beetle indoors in summer flew in through an open window or door and is a stray rather than an infestation. Collect it and put it outside, or vacuum it up. If beetles are entering in numbers, check screens and door sweeps, and consider whether outdoor lighting near an entrance is drawing them. Realistic Expectations
You cannot eliminate Japanese beetles from a property. Adults fly considerable distances, and beetles from surrounding yards, fields, and roadsides continually recolonize any area you clear, so even a perfectly executed grub treatment on your own lawn does not prevent adults arriving from elsewhere.
The realistic goal is damage reduction on the plants you care about. A combination of daily hand-picking during the flight period, evening neem applications on high-value plants, row covers where practical, and no irrigation during egg-laying weeks brings most home gardens to a tolerable level.
Populations also fluctuate substantially year to year, driven by rainfall during egg-laying and by natural enemies including parasitic wasps and tachinid flies. A severe year is often followed by a milder one, and avoiding broad-spectrum insecticides preserves the natural enemies that drive that decline. Neighborhood-scale coordination on grub treatment works better than any individual effort, which is worth raising if several nearby properties have the same problem.

Will Japanese beetles kill my plants?
Rarely. Adults skeletonize leaves, which looks severe, but established trees and shrubs usually recover, and damage late in the season has little effect since the plant has already stored energy for the year. Young plants, newly planted trees, and repeatedly defoliated shrubs are the ones genuinely at risk.
